Description of The Social History of Achaemenid Phoenicia

This monograph explores the evidence from Persian-period literary, epigraphic, and numismatic sources, as well as material culture remains, in order to sketch just such a history. This study examines developments in Persian-period Phoenician city-states on the three levels.
